Output f0d97efd23db12b28afef18c7810874ab057d1a7142cb28222f762459a4d66a1:1

value
40000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7857cf54aaf7a7a9e5a4dad30b38a9d27d6757d OP_EQUAL
address
3KszJdnWpX91qFsXgBEo48ZpKL2ENehmQN
transaction
f0d97efd23db12b28afef18c7810874ab057d1a7142cb28222f762459a4d66a1
confirmations
378198
spent
true